Summary
Willington Primary School is a mixed community school located in Crook, County Durham, with a current enrolment of 178 pupils against a capacity of 210. The school prioritises an inclusive ethos, as highlighted by its "No Outsiders" initiative, which fosters a welcoming environment for all students. Headteacher Mrs K. Harker leads a dedicated team committed to the personal and educational development of every child.
The curriculum at Willington Primary covers a broad range of subjects, including English, Maths, Science, and the Arts, alongside a strong emphasis on physical education and personal development. The school also provides a comprehensive Early Years Foundation Stage (EYFS) curriculum, ensuring a solid foundation for younger learners.
Support for students with special educational needs is a key focus, with tailored provisions in place to help these children thrive academically and socially. The school actively engages with parents through initiatives like the Arbor management system, ensuring effective communication and community involvement in school activities.
